From dece31f41ee096712a4415f09f4f9725068efe9d Mon Sep 17 00:00:00 2001 From: Neil Alexander Date: Fri, 24 Jan 2020 11:40:27 +0000 Subject: Some fixes for #847 (#850) * Fix a couple of cases where backfilling events we already had causes panics, hopefully fix ordering of events, update GMSL dependency for backfill URL fixes * Remove commented out lines from output_room_events_table schema --- syncapi/routing/messages.go |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'syncapi/routing/messages.go') diff --git a/syncapi/routing/messages.go b/syncapi/routing/messages.go index 26f48ca4..eb678296 100644 --- a/syncapi/routing/messages.go +++ b/syncapi/routing/messages.go @@ -222,13 +222,13 @@ func (r *messagesReq) retrieveEvents() ( // reliable way to define it), it would be easier and less troublesome to // only have to change it in one place, i.e. the database. startPos, err := r.db.EventPositionInTopology( - r.ctx, streamEvents[0].EventID(), + r.ctx, events[0].EventID(), ) if err != nil { return } endPos, err := r.db.EventPositionInTopology( - r.ctx, streamEvents[len(streamEvents)-1].EventID(), + r.ctx, events[len(events)-1].EventID(), ) if err != nil { return -- cgit v1.2.3